Clever Organization Methods in Custom Cabinets
When room is scarce, custom cabinets deliver effective smart storage solutions that enhance functionality without sacrificing style. These cabinets can be customized to feature pull-out shelves, hidden compartments, and built-in organizers, which make it simpler to keep spaces clutter-free. For kitchens, features like lazy Susans and pull-down racks improve accessibility while maximizing corner spaces that frequently go unused. In living rooms, custom cabinets may include media centers with cable management solutions, keeping all electronics organized. Furthermore, vertical storage options integrated into the design let homeowners utilize ceiling height effectively, increasing storage capacity. By marrying aesthetic appeal with practical design, custom cabinets convert everyday spaces into tidy havens, ensuring each item is well-placed. This thoughtful design approach not only elevates home functionality but also enhances overall visual balance.
What Options Work Best for Your Made-to-Order Cabinets?
Selecting the appropriate materials for custom cabinets significantly impacts both durability and aesthetics. Homeowners often consider various wood types, with hardwoods such as oak, maple, and cherry being popular choices for their strength and aesthetic qualities. Plywood is another preferred choice, recognized for its structural integrity and resistance to warping.
To achieve a modern look, laminates and MDF (medium-density fiberboard) provide design flexibility while remaining cost-effective. Additionally, glass and metal components can be added for a contemporary edge.
Finishes equally contribute a significant function; pigments, paints, and lacquers boost the organic appeal of wood while delivering defense against deterioration.
Ultimately, choosing finishes should align with both functional requirements and personal style, guaranteeing that the custom cabinets not only fulfill their function but also enhance the overall aesthetic of the home.

How long Does the Custom Cabinet Design Process Typically Take?
The bespoke cabinetry creation process typically takes four to eight weeks. This timeframe includes initial meetings, design revisions, material selection, and finalizing details, ensuring a customized approach that satisfies the client's particular needs and requirements.
What Is the Average Cost of Bespoke Cabinets?
The standard price of tailored cabinets generally spans from $500 to $1,200 per linear foot, affected by materials, design intricacy, and manufacturer. Homeowners should save appropriately to achieve their ideal quality and style.
